WebThe natural outcome of this requirement is a wing design that is thin and wide, which has a low thickness-to-chord ratio. At lower speeds, undesirable parasitic drag is largely a function of the total surface area, which suggests using a wing with minimum chord, leading to the high aspect ratios seen on light aircraft and regional airliners ... WebThe aircraft wings whose leading edges are swept back are called swept back wings. Swept back wings reduce drag when an aircraft is flying at transonic speeds. The majority of high-speed commercial aircrafts use swept back wings. Boeing 787 Dreamliner is one example out of many that uses swept back wings. 8. WebAccording to Lifting Line Theory, the lift coefficient can be calculated in the following way: where. C L = 3D wing lift coefficient. C lα = 2D airfoil lift coefficient slope. AR = wing aspect ratio. α = angle of attack in radians. Note that this equation is of the same form as that derived from Thin Airfoil Theory.
